A Roth IRA is taxed differently and thus has different tax outcomes if you decide to transfer the balance to a savings account. While traditional IRAs tax the money when you withdraw it, Roth IRAs tax the money when you deposit it. To ...A retirement money market account is a high-yield, interest-generating savings account within a retirement investment vehicle. Cash deposited in a retirement money market account stays there until it’s used to purchase investment products such as stocks, bonds and mutual funds. Best High-Yield Savings Accounts; Best Checking Accounts; Best Personal Loans;Managing your finances can feel like a daunting task, but with the right …Savings account interest is taxed at the same rate as your earned income. The interest you earn on regular savings, high-yield savings, money market accounts or certificates of deposit is reported to the IRS on Form 1099-INT. You should receive a separate 1099-INT from every financial institution with which you hold an interest-earning …
